Conway's Law in the Age of AI Agents: Why We Gave Engineers the Product Decisions
We had a product leader writing detailed specs in one timezone and five engineers building them in another. That worked fine until AI agents could take a spec and produce reliable code. Suddenly our engineers were doing the same job as a machine, only slower, and the real bottleneck was product decisions sitting in someone else's inbox eight hours away.
So we stopped writing detailed specs. We gave engineers high-level product requirements and told them to make the calls themselves. They went from implementers to decision-makers. In five weeks, issues completed per sprint doubled and median time-to-merge halved from 4.6 to 2.3 hours with the same team & same tools.
This talk's about recognising when AI makes a Conway's Law problem visible that was always there, how we restructured ownership across a remote team, what went well, and what we got wrong.
